Abstract

Seruway is one of the sub-districts in Aceh Tamiang, which is located in the coastal area. This coastal area is dominated by mangrove species, where the mangrove area is used as a habitat for aquatic biota animals, one of which is gastropods. Gastropods are soft-bodied animals that have threaded shells. This research aims to determine the value of the species diversity index and distribution patterns of gastropods in Kupang Beach, Seruway District. This research is a type of quantitative descriptive research with sampling using a survey method. Sampling was taken using transects. Sampling was divided into 3 stations, namely the first station in the mangrove area, the second station in the beach area and the third station in the pond area. Each station consists of 4 transects measuring 50 meters, each transect has 4 plots measuring 10x10m. Samples that are obtained will be identified using an identification book. The research results showed that the number of gastropod species found was 17 species from 9 families with a total diversity index value at the research location, namely H'= 2.405, which is classified as medium. The distribution pattern of gastropods on Kupang Beach falls into two categories, namely the uniform category 59% and the undefined category 41%.

Keywords: Identifikasi;Pteridophyta;Universitas Samudra. Abstract Lower plants called ferns (Pteridophyta) reproduce using spores rather than seeds. Ferns (Pteridophyta) which are members of the Lygodiaceae, Lomariopsidaceae and Dryopteridaceae families are most commonly found in the Samudra University area. This research aims to identify Pterydophyta species in the Ocean University area. This research uses an exploratory and descriptive survey approach, data collection techniques by examining the morphology and description of the plants. The samples were identified using the key identification book, namely the plant taxonomy book. In this study, 14 different species of Pterydophyta were obtained, which were divided into 9 families, namely the Polypodiaceae, Nephrolepidaceae, Dryopteridaceae, Lygodiaceae, Stenochlaena, Gleicheniaceae, Thelypteridaceae, Lomariopsidaceae, Pteridaceae families. Abstract

The coastal area of ​​Pangkalan Susu is a place with diverse marine biota. Apart from being a spawning place and source of nutrition, coastal areas are also a source of food for various marine biota, including gastropods and bivalves Morphometry is the size or comparison of external body size between one part and another. This research was carried out in September 2023 on the coast of Pangkalan Susu, Langkat Regency. Sampling was carried out in plots. Bivalves are grouped into 3 length classes, namely small size (1.0 cm – 2.0 cm), medium size (2.1cm – 3.0 cm), large size (>3.1cm). Based on the collection of bivalve species at each location, 3 species of bivalves were obtained. The 3 species of bivalves obtained were Anadara granosa, Placuna placenta and Atrina pectinata. All bivalve species are large in size. Morphometrics of the three bivalve species showed that location 1 showed higher values ​​compared to location 1 in terms of length, width and weight.
